Exception when opening from Safari Browser

I have a web application developed in ASP.Net 2.0. In one of the page, I have a functionality in which i have a PDF on left hand side of web page and on right hand side I have a quiz.
The issue is whenever i am trying to save the quiz using MAC machine with SAFARI Browser I am getting exception.
Exception message: Invalid postback or callback argument. Event validation is enabled using <pages enableEventValidation="true"/> in configuration or <%@ Page EnableEventValidation="true" %> in a page. For security purposes, this feature verifies that arguments to postback or callback events originate from the server control that originally rendered them. If the data is valid and expected, use the ClientScriptManager.RegisterForEventValidation method in order to register the postback or callback data for validation.
This working fine in Internet explorer in Windows OS or Mozilla Firefox in MAC machine.

    Try this.
    Force Quit .
    Press command + option + esc keys together at the same time. Wait.
    When Force Quit window appears, select  Safari if not already.
    Press Force Quit button at the bottom of the window.   Wait.
    Safari will quit.
    Relaunch Safari holding the shift key down.

  • Forms Opening is Very slow when opened from Client PC's.

    All,
    We are running forms application in 10.1.2.0 application server. We have a peculiar issue of slowness while opening forms from client PC's and not while opening from application server itself.
    1) When opening the form from a Windows 7 PC it takes around 25 seconds
    2) When opening the form from a Windows XP PC it takes around 15 seconds
    3) When opening the form from the application server itself it took less than 3 seconds .
    In essence all forms when opened from application server are opening very fast and when opened from client PC's it takes undue time. What might be the reason for the same, can anyone help us and we are pondering over this issue for some time. What are the files of interest to be visited for these kind of issues. We enabled tracing level 5 in JRE and could not find any thing fishy over it.
    Request application server and forms experts to participate and help us to resolve.
    Thanks in advance.

    Even if it's a generic issue you need to break it down in smaller parts to actually get a clue what's causing your problem. By now there is nothing we can rule out as the only thing we know is that it's slow on the client PC's.
    Building a small dummy form as suggested by Andreas is a good starting point. If the performance is also bad for a small form with one block you can rule out that it has anything to do with forms and it's caused by e.g. your network. If the small form performs well rebuild one of your forms step by step and do tests for each step. By that you should find what's causing troubles.
    What you can also take a look at are network roundtrips: You have to set the console window of your forms, and enable networkstats in your formsweb.cfg
    networkStats=yesA typical cause for (unnecessary) roundtrips are e.g. calls to the synchronize built in or timers. If you are using Javabeans you should also take a look at them. If you are looking at your network traffic wireshark is your friend ;).
